"Vires artes mores" is pronounced as "vee-res ar-tes mo-res." Each word is pronounced with the emphasis typically placed on the first syllable. The "v" in "vires" sounds like a "v" in "victory," and "a" in "artes" is pronounced like the "a" in "father."
